The terms First, Second and Third Worldwere originally used to classify countries regarding their alliances in the Cold War. This reference was then generalized into referring to the level of development of the industry, economy and lifestyle of the countries, and has been replaced with the terms Developed, Developing and Under-developed.

According to the HDI or Human Development Index of the United Nations, New Zealand has a rating of 0.95 on a scale where 1= fully developed and 0= fully undeveloped, which puts New Zealand in the top category of development.

This rating takes may variables into account, and while some variables for New Zealand are not high in their ratings, overall New Zealand is definitely a developed country.
One rating is per capita GDP, and New Zealand is ranked at 23rd to 29th (out of a total of 170 -192) depending on the ranking organisation.

Although the South African economy may be 4 times the size of the New Zealand economy and post an average GDP growth rate of 3 to 4 percent per year. New Zealand with it's low population and low unemployment rate has a higher per capita GDP rate when compared to South Africa. New Zealand may be considered a First world country, but many argue that South Africa's economic potential and attractive growth rates still surpass New Zealand in FDI due to it's role on the continent and the world. So per capita New Zealand would appear richer, but as a country South Africa's GDP is Richer or higher than New Zealand's overall GDP.
